For a follow-up lesson about contractions, students entered the room and were immediately addressed as doctors. I wanted this to be a bit performance-based. This is a great way to boost engagement without adding too much time to the lesson, and it is possible to turn any number of lessons into performances. Each "doctor" used their desk as an operating table... no sitting, they had surgery to perform! Wearing surgical masks and rubber gloves, the doctors used scalpels (scissors) and stitches (tape) to join their words together as contractions. They had to call out for these supplies. Doctors would say, "Scalpel," and I would present them with scissors. "Scalpel." Actual band-aids were used as the apostrophe. Perhaps you've seen this online or on Pinterest before. I added an extension activity so that the students would have to use their contractions in writing. What comes after surgery? Well, a prescription, of course! In this case, our stu....er, doctors wrote prescriptions to their patients about what to do and what not to do in order to get better. This resource is help students describe the parts of the body and to describe people, family members and later on even animals. Body unit draw book: Let them recognize that everybody in class is different. Have the students draw their bodies as they read the sentences. The grammar points are: possessive adjectives (This is my face) and demostratives (These are my legs) Watch the video of the printable book: To learn Body Words Board Activity 1: Draw several shapes as torsos on the board . Have children come up to the complete the body. Teacher: karla and Paul, draw the head. Continue with more body parts until the drawing is complete. Go over all the body parts and label them. Then, have children draw themselves with their complete bodies and label all their body parts. Board Activity 2: Divide the class in several teams. Have a student from each team go to the board. Say a body vocabulary word and have the students write it on the board as fast as they can. Give a point to each team that does it correctly. Continue with more words. Children can count with their fingers. I printed onto cardboard a right and left hand. Then I glued all the numbers onto clothespin. Students have to number all the fingers in the hand. Adjectives Left and right related to the body: teach directionality during this unit. Have students hold both hands in front of themselves. Use the hands and arrows available for this purpose. You can make them smaller and paste the hands on their tables to remind them of left and right. Have students say right hand and show it to you. Do the same with left hand. This is booklet 1 called EAL worksheets and Games for Initial Learners School Vocabulary. There are 4 other booklets available in the pack containing vocabulary building worksheets and games for Initial Learners of English. All 5 booklets are printable. The topics covered in the pack are 1. School, 2. Colour 3. Number 4. School Clothes 5. Food and Drinks. Worksheets and games are suitable for use from age 8 to adult. The booklets could be suitable for use with a group of refugees who have a wide age range and who are beginning to learn English. The word matching activities could be particularly useful for students who have had little education in their first language and perhaps might not be literate in their first language. Some games could be used with children younger than 8 years. Consolidation of new vocabulary is possible by using a range of different worksheets and games. By using this pack, Initial Learners should be able to achieve success and build confidence in the early days of acquiring English. The skills developed by using the worksheets are reading and writing.Games provide opportunities for the development of speaking and listening. The vocabulary is introduced in three sections in this booklet - School (1) pencil, rubber, pen, pencil case, ruler, book, table, bag, sharpener, scissors, glue stick, chair. School (2) toilet, jotter/ notebook, lunch box, water bottle, window, door, bin, sink, cupboard, desk, felt tips, crayon. School (3) television, computer, clock, paint, paint brush, stapler, white board, black board, chalk, smart board, sand shoes, shorts. There is a read and say reference page, at the beginning of each section. These reference pages enable students to complete worksheets by themselves. A record of work sheet is also provided. Photographs have been used so that items are easily identified. Games/ activities also included are snap, picture and word matching,dominoes - picture to picture, dominoes picture to word and bingo. It is recommended that that the game pieces should be either laminated or printed on card for durability. Crosswords and word searches are also included. The Suffixes Board Game is a fun way for students to practice identifying and defining suffixes. Students answer suffixes questions and race against each other to be the first to reach the finish! A game board and 50 question cards are included in the product. Suffixes covered in this game: –able: capable of; can be done _al: relating to –ed: past tense –en: made of –er: person who; more; comparitive –es: more than one –est: most; comparitive –ful: full of –ing: present tense –ist: a person who –less: without –ly: in a certain way; how often something is done –ment: the act of –ness: being; state of –ology: study of; science of –or: person who –ous: full of; having –s: more than one –y: having; being You might also be interested in my Prefixes Board Game

This game provides a fun way for students to learn / reinforce the irregular past tense of a range of over fifty commonly used English irregular verbs. Two versions of the game board are available. One has a white background and the other has a coloured background. The verbs on the board are in the present tense. A reference sheet containing the present and past tense forms of the verbs is also included for use during the game by players to verify that the student, saying the past tense of the verb, has provided the correct form of the past tense. Instructions for the game and a template for making a die are also available. The Instructions can be seen in the preview.
